Message from Revd Stuart Leck

On behalf of the Food Project please pass on our thanks to the Rangefield School Community for the generous donations provided at the Harvest assemblies.

The food and toiletries will be used to support individuals and families in our local community who are struggling due to the current economic environment in which we
are all living. It was also a pleasure to take the assemblies and the children engaged very well with the themes that we thought about – gratitude for our food and drink, to be good stewards of all that we have been given and to share so all have sufficient to eat and drink.

Tola Okogwu visits Rangefield!

Rangefield had a special visit from famous author Tola Okogwu today! She taught us all about writing books and creating our own worlds. We learned that she was inspired by her own husband and daughter to write her first book – Daddy do my hair and her famous Onyeka series (which is going to become a series on Netflix) was inspired by her own journey through life. Thank you for sharing your knowledge with us Tola!
